How to Buy Clothes Online From the UK

The UK has a variety of fashion brands and products, ranging from fashionable womenswear to stylish menswear. Selfridges, Harrods and other famous department stores are located in the UK.

However, purchasing clothes from UK retailers can be a challenge for those outside the country. Many stores have shipping restrictions which make it difficult to purchase their clothes internationally.

Another option to shop for clothes online is to use a parcel forwarding company like Forward2me. These services give you the UK shipping adress and can take your orders from different websites and deliver them to you in a single package. This is an excellent solution for those who live abroad or wish to bypass the shipping restrictions of many websites based in the UK.

In the end, if you're trying to purchase clothes from the UK but aren't in the UK you can avail an online service such as Jetkrate. This will give you an unique UK address which you can use to shop with every retailer. The company will store your purchases until they are able to ship them to you. This is a great option for people who are moving to the UK or for those who do not have a family member or friend in the country.
